Radio frequency emission reduction with interference cancellation

13. An apparatus comprising:
a processing system that includes one or more processors and one or more memories coupled with the one or more processors, the processing system configured to cause the apparatus to:
receive a configuration from a network for uplink transmission according to an uplink frequency allocation;
receive an instruction from the network identifying a frequency area associated with a sidelink communication for interference cancellation with respect to the uplink frequency allocation;
modulating a plurality of symbols on the uplink frequency allocation and on a plurality of interference cancellation subcarriers based on the frequency area
transmit a sidelink waveform to a second apparatus; and
transmit a waveform to the network, the waveform including the plurality of symbols without applying interference cancellation to an automatic gain control (AGC) symbol of the sidelink communication.
